When it comes to exterior decking, you have two main options to choose from – thermally modified wood decking vs natural wood decking. Both have benefits and drawbacks, so it’s essential to understand the difference between them before deciding which one is right for your needs.

Durability

Thermally modified wood decking is more durable than natural wood decking because it is less susceptible to rot, decay, and insect damage. Thermal modification makes the wood harder and more resistant to the elements.

Stability

Thermally modified wood deck is more stable than natural wood decking because it expands and contracts less with changes in temperature and humidity. Your deck will be less likely to warp or cup over time.

Maintenance

Thermally modified wood decking requires less maintenance than natural wood decking because it is more resistant to stains and fading. You won’t worry about frequently refinishing or re-staining your decking.
